This virus is very common and highly contagious. It … Cold sores — also called fever blisters — are a common viral infection. They are tiny, fluid-filled blisters on and around your lips. These blisters are often grouped together in patches. After the blisters break, a scab forms that can last several days. Cold sores usually heal in two to three weeks without leaving a scar. Herpes labialis occurs when herpes simplex virus type 1 comes in contact with oral mucosal tissue or abraded skin of the mouth. Kissing or oral sex with an infected person can cause transmission of infection. WitrynaOral herpes is an infection of the lips, mouth, or gums due to the herpes simplex virus. It causes small, painful blisters commonly called cold sores or fever blisters. Oral herpes is also called herpes ... It is caused by the herpes simplex virus type 1 (HSV-1). Most people in the United States are infected with this virus by age 20.
